What are PWAs and Why They Matter Now?
PWAs leverage modern web capabilities to deliver app-like experiences directly within users’ browsers. They are fast, reliable, and can function offline, making them a perfect solution in today’s fast-paced environment. In the wake of increased mobile usage and changing user expectations, businesses that adopt PWAs can stand out in crowded markets.
The Latest Innovations Driving PWA Adoption
- Enhanced Performance: Recent browser updates have significantly improved the speed and responsiveness of PWAs. With features like service workers, developers can ensure instant loading times, even on slower networks.
- Increased Engagement: Notifications and home screen installations encourage user interaction. Companies that have integrated PWAs have reported increases in engagement metrics, proving their effectiveness in capturing and retaining customer attention.
- Broader Device Compatibility: Unlike traditional apps limited by operating system restrictions, PWAs run on any platform with a web browser. This universality allows businesses to reach a wider audience without the overhead of multiple app versions.

Real-World Success Stories
Several notable companies have realized substantial benefits from adopting PWAs. For instance, Twitter Lite saw a significant increase in engagement and lower bounce rates. Similarly, Alibaba reported a 76% increase in conversion rates after moving to a PWA framework.
